Le 'Guide de l'au-delà' d'Ornella Volta est un essai satirique et érudit qui propose une description humoristique et critique des conceptions de l'Enfer et du Paradis à travers l'histoire et les cultures. L'ouvrage initialement publié en 1977 et réédité mêle érudition historique et ton caustique pour explorer les représentations de l'au-delà

As to the content of the book, it is much more than a collection of the finest pieces, newly expanded and updated, by one of Canada's best-known commentators on religion. In addition to a lengthy introductory statement of his own beliefs, the former relition editor of The Toronto Star has written a number of short essays on controversial issues specially for this book. Here, Harpur is able to speak more frankly than he could as a journalist. A book not only for church-goers but for all who are concerned with religion and its place in the world. Book
